Документация в BI-проектах часто воспринимается как второстепенная задача. Пока команда небольшая и все «держат модель в голове», это работает. Но по мере роста системы отсутствие документации превращается в серьёзный риск.
Что нужно документировать
Минимальный набор: архитектура (как устроены источники, DWH, витрины, семантический слой), бизнес-словари (что означают ключевые показатели и поля), правила расчётов (формулы KPI и мер DAX), процессы обновления и поддержки.
Для кого пишется документация
Для разработчиков — чтобы было проще поддерживать и развивать систему. Для аналитиков и продвинутых пользователей — чтобы понимать ограничения и логику показателей. Для менеджмента — чтобы иметь прозрачность и возможность смены подрядчика или расширения команды.
Форматы документации
Это могут быть wiki-системы, markdown-репозитории рядом с кодом, схемы архитектуры, каталоги данных, описания отчётов. Важно, чтобы документация была доступна, структурирована и поддерживалась в актуальном состоянии.
Документация и независимость бизнеса
Хорошая документация снижает зависимость от конкретных людей и подрядчиков. Компания сохраняет контроль над своей BI-системой и может спокойно масштабировать или менять исполнителей.
Итог
Документация — не бюрократия, а страховка от рисков и основа устойчивости BI-платформы. Чем раньше она появляется, тем дешевле обходятся будущие изменения.